#9bb49c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9bb49c is composed of 60.8% red, 70.6%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.3%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 122.4 degrees, a saturation of 14.3% and a lightness of 65.7%. #9bb49c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#376939.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

● #9bb49c color description : Grayish lime green.
#9bb49c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9bb49c has RGB values of R:155, G:180,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0, Y:0.13,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 10204316.

Shades and Tints of #9bb49c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f5f7f5 is the lightest one.
